Pork Roll Egg and Cheese
Is this NOT the most perfect sandwich ever created? Personally, I think they're absolutely delicious and especially when baked. Not too many will know what I am talkin about unfortunately.. Pork roll is kinda regional and really is only used like that here in New Jersey. So yeah if you don't already know pork roll is sliced into circular pieces that are a little bit thicker than your average cold cut and is kinda spicy and very tasty! I work in a bagel place and for our pork roll egg and cheese we use three pieces of pork roll, a fried egg, and two slices of american cheese with some salt, pepper, and ketchup. It is served hot (obviously) and if you've never had one or heard of one find it ASAP!
